I really don’t think this is worth the money. Beware that the train doesn’t have air conditioning so on a hot day it’s a little stuffy. We were expecting a scenic ride with mountain views, but you really only see trees and brush. The whole experience takes around an hour, but the train is only moving for maybe twenty minutes. That is a long time on a hot train with no airflow. The conductor tells stories about train crashes and deaths by trains which was a little off putting with kids on the train. He does let everyone get off and smash coins on the track, which was fun. If you and your kids have never been on a train, this might be fun. If you have been on a train then I don’t really think it is worth the money or the time.(Note this is for the regular ride, not the train ride with food)

The train ride wasn’t what I thought it was going to be. The scenery wasn’t that great. And to make it worse, the train went for a couple miles, then stopped for a few minutes, and then went in reverse to get back to the depot. For some reason I assumed that the train would be going in a big loop, not reversing and going the same way we came. So the ride itself was disappointing. The food was underwhelming. They serve it to you in this order: tomato pasta soup – good salad – good roll – ok entrée – I got prime rib and it wasn’t that great. It comes with rice pilaf and veggies. The rice pilaf was really gummy and the veggies were just ok. dessert – The dessert was a baked Alaska. It was just ok. The cake part of it was really dry. Our waitress was friendly so that made it a more enjoyable experience. Eating on a train was a fun experience, but overall it just wasn’t as good as I thought it was going to be.

The train ride is about an hour long that begins near town so it takes a bit to get to the real scenery. Once you get going the views are decent, but honestly you can see as nice a view(if not better) from the roadways in the area. The train ride itself is a neat experience if you have never ridden on one of these old trains, but if you have done it before there wasn’t much novel about this adventure. We took the lunch train and dined on-board. The price for lunch over a regular excursion ticket was not excessive, and the food quality was superb. The service was very attentive. Although one server took care of the entire dining car it seemed as if we had more personal attention.
